Colorado’s DUI laws are among the toughest in the nation, with penalties that can include substantial fines, license suspension, and even jail time. A key factor in determining these penalties is the blood alcohol content (BAC) level at the time of arrest. In Colorado, it is illegal to operate a vehicle with a BAC of 0.08% or higher for individuals over 21 years old. For commercial drivers and minors, the legal limit is significantly lower, at 0.04%. Comparatively, many other states in the US have a BAC limit of 0.08%, making Colorado’s laws more stringent.

When facing DUI charges in Boulder, an individual could be subject to various penalties based on their BAC and prior driving history. First-time offenders might receive a fine, license suspension for up to one year, and completion of a DUI education program. More severe cases can lead to extended license suspensions, fines exceeding $1000, and even prison time, especially if the DUI results in an accident or causes significant property damage. It’s also important to note that a fourth DUI offense within 10 years is considered a felony in Colorado, leading to more stringent penalties including lengthy jail sentences and permanent loss of driving privileges.

Additionally, individuals on DUI probation in Colorado must adhere to specific requirements. This includes regular check-ins with probation officers, participation in treatment programs, and often, installation of an ignition interlock device (IID) in their vehicles. Failure to comply with these conditions can result in revocation of probation and more severe penalties. The Role of Breathalyzer Tests and Expert Witnesses

Colorado DUI Penalties Lawyer

In Boulder, Colorado, navigating a DUI (Driving Under the Influence) charge can be daunting, with potential consequences that could impact your freedom, finances, and future. The role of breathalyzer tests and expert witnesses is pivotal in these cases. Breathalyzer results, while often considered conclusive, are not infallible and can be challenged by experienced Colorado DUI Penalties Lawyers. They employ scientific expertise to scrutinize the testing procedures, ensuring that every step aligns with state-mandated standards. For instance, a slight deviation in temperature or calibration could significantly affect readings.

Expert witnesses play an equally critical role. These professionals—ranging from toxicologists to former law enforcement officers—offer insights beyond the scope of typical testimony. They can elaborate on the metabolism of alcohol, potential sources of false positives (like certain medications or foods), and the variability in breathalyzer technology.
